Abstract
The invention discloses a flattening die for T-shaped iron. The flattening die comprises a fixed lower flattening die and an upper flattening die arranged in up-down movable mode. A first mounting hole is formed at the center of the lower flattening die, an ejector pin is mounted at the lower portion of the first mounting hole, and a lower die core is mounted on the upper portion of the first mounting hole. A T-shaped hole is formed at the center of the lower die core and is communicated with the lower portion of the first mounting hole. The upper end of the ejector pin extends into the T-shaped hole. A second mounting hole is formed at the center of the upper flattering die, an upper die core is mounted on the lower portion of the second mounting hole, and the bottom surface of the upper die core is recessed to form an arc-shaped groove corresponding to the T-shaped hole. The flattening die for the T-shaped iron is raw-material saving, low in processing cost and high in production efficiency.

Please refer to Fig. 1, described T iron flattens mould and comprises the flattening counterdie 1 that is fixedly installed and the flattening patrix 2 of up and down setting.
The center of described flattening counterdie 1 is provided with the first installing hole 11, the bottom of described the first installing hole 11 is provided with thimble 3, the top of described the first installing hole 11 is provided with counterdie core rod 12, the end face of described counterdie core rod 12 is concordant with the end face of described flattening counterdie 1, described counterdie core rod 12 center is provided with T-shaped hole 121, described T-shaped hole 121 is communicated with the bottom of described the first installing hole 11, and the upper end of described thimble 3 is stretched in described T-shaped hole 121.
The center of described flattening patrix 2 is provided with the second installing hole 21, the bottom of described the second installing hole 21 is provided with upper mould core 22, the bottom surface of described upper mould core 22 is concordant with the bottom surface of described flattening patrix 2, the bottom surface of described upper mould core 22 is recessed to form arc groove 221, and described arc groove 221 is corresponding with described T-shaped hole 121.
The operation principle that T iron of the present invention flattens mould is: workpiece 4 is placed in the T-shaped hole 121 of described counterdie core rod 12, described flattening counterdie 1 maintains static, described flattening patrix 2 is in the downward punching press of certain height, until described flattening patrix 2 is pressed onto the desired flattening size of drawing workpiece 4, then 2 liters of described flattening patrixes return original height, and the thimble 3 in described flattening counterdie 1 ejects described flattening counterdie 1 workpiece 4.
In sum, adopt the T iron flattening mould of said structure directly to large wire rod, to carry out punching press formation T iron product, and do not need other lathe processing, not only saved raw material, and processing cost is low, production efficiency is high.
